Festival

• Cook Township Community Center will host its third annual Backyard Brewfest from 3 to 9 p.m. Aug. 10 at the center, 1714 Route 711. Must be 21. There will be food and music. Cost: $10, in advance; $15, at the gate. Tickets: tinyurl.com/mptr5dh9.

Fundraisers

• Westmoreland County Blind Association is accepting sponsorships for its third annual super bingo planned Oct. 5 at West Point Firehall, 100 Volunteer Drive, Hempfield. Details: wcbainpa.org.

• A fundraiser to benefit Mon Valley Paws will be from 4 to 8:30 p.m. Aug. 7 at Trailside Restaurant, 108 W. Main St., West Newton. A portion of all purchases will be donated and there will be a basket auction, 50-50 raffle and pet supply collection. Details: 724-493-8305.

Senior Citizen News

• Irwin Senior Activity Center, 310 Oak St., will have trivia at 10 a.m. Aug. 6. National Lighthouse Day will be observed on Aug. 7. Bring a photo of your favorite lighthouse. Details: 724-787-1760.
